**Responsibilities**:

- In essence you will be part of a team of carers (divided into sub teams) and working on a rolling rota to provide ongoing care and support to the young people.
- The ‘shift’ has a Team Leader and/or Senior leading and coordinating and then a team of therapeutic carers - typically 6-7 adults working together evenings and weekends, more around during office and school hours
- Safeguarding and managing boundaries is a key part of the role - but we do this with very open communication and active use of relationships - we have very low levels of incidents, safeguarding referrals or more extreme challenging behaviours.
- The role is varied from hour to hour, day to day - on one level it is about (re)parenting the boys - so everything from well-being, role modelling, guide, mentor, nurture, firm boundaries, listening, playing, helping with homework, cooking, gardening, gaming, bikes, walks and activities, bedtime stories and settling, the list is endless
- As the role is varied, we need a variety of people on the team, people with different skills and talents, but also open to trying new things
- We have our own school on site and our own therapy team - so part of the role is about integrating with that wider team - the whole service operates as a ‘therapeutic community’ and so we have a lot of spaces for staff to reflect on their work in teams and together with the boys.
- This is work based on the relationships between everyone - boys, staff, up, down and sideways - we place a lot of support on helping staff develop their own self-awareness in relationship to others.
